			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://akpaniko.files.wordpress.com/2011/11/police1.jpg"><img src="http://akpaniko.files.wordpress.com/2011/11/police1.jpg?w=217&#038;h=300" alt="" title="Nigerian police men on duty" width="217" height="300" class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-47" /></a>What exactly is wrong with the Nigerian Society? What is the solution to this rampant and ever increasing incidence of bribery in the police force? Do the Nigerian Police understand that Corruption is destructive to personal, and governmental structures and capacity?<br />
My experiences I had while travelling along Etim Ekpo – Iwukem Road to Aba and Aba – Ikot Ekpene Road exposed the reality of what is have been hearing and reading about police extortion and exploitation from innocent road users. What I saw, pointed to the fact that CORRUPTION has destroyed the legitimacy (if any) of the security agency.<br />
At every poll along the roads aforementioned, there is a police check point. I believe the reason for this check point is to protect and ensure the security of life and property of the road users as well as checkmate the infiltration of the society by criminals who may want to transport harmful weapons or substances via this route. But, this check point has been turn into EXTORTION POINTS, the drivers plying this roads a made to part with a NON-NEGOTIABLE FEE of N50 at every ‘check point’ manned by the men and women of the Nigerian mobile police force while they are expected to stop their vehicle and come down to settle the HIGHWAY PATROL men who sit comfortably in their duty vehicle, with an amount not less than one hundred Naira.  At a particular check point within Aba main town the driver brought out fifty naira and gave it to the police man, to my greatest surprise the police man refuse it demanding for an additional N50.  At another point along the Aba – Ikot Ekpene Road – precisely close at Ikot Umoh Essien &#8211; my bus driver wanting to deliver the bride, the money fell on the road and he was order to come down and pick the money and deliver it properly into his (the policeman’s) hand. What a Country.</p>
<p>These corrupt officers (fathers and mothers) extort scarce public resources into private pockets, literally undermining the security of the nation, and eroding the social and moral fabric of nations. They no longer stop the vehicle for the proper checks as they case may be; just N50 gives you a visa to drive around legitimately irrespective of whether you are carrying a contraband or not. These men are not doing their duty, instead, they are focused on making money illegally and there is no clear difference between the Nigerian police offices and highway armed robbers – they are all brutal, selfish and extortionist. Will it be possible for Nigeria to effectively tame the scourge of police extortion on our highways?<br />
STOP BRIBERY TODAY!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://akpaniko.files.wordpress.com/2011/10/agu.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-31" title="AGU" src="http://akpaniko.files.wordpress.com/2011/10/agu.jpg?w=300&#038;h=197" alt="" width="300" height="197" /></a>The RCCG London Pastor Agu Irukwu is an outspoken man of God, one has no option but to love his teachings of the work of God.</p>
<p>According to METRO, Agu Irukwu was chosen by 54 per cent of voters in a competition organised by Mayor of London Boris Johnson and Metro. He was picked from a shortlist that also included US president Barack Obama, former South African leader Nelson Mandela and US human rights activist Martin Luther King. Former investment banker Mr Irukwu, senior pastor of Jesus House in London since 1994, has come under fire for his outspoken views on homosexuality.<br />
The married father of three signed a letter sent to a national newspaper, attacking laws which force churches to accept gay people. Mr Johnson, who voted for Muhammad Ali in the poll, has previously been criticised by gay rights campaigner Peter Tatchell for accepting Warwick University law graduate Mr Irukwu’s invitation to a carol service.</p>
<p>The competition takes place during Black History Month, which champions black culture, history and heritage, and seeks to recognise the contribution made by black people to Britain.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>CALABAR - Ibrahim Muhammad, Zamfara Commissioner for Information, has called on the government to ban traditional rulers from holding political meetings with politicians.</p>
<p>Muhammad made the call in a memorandum he presented to the 42nd Meeting of the National Council on Information and Communication, which began in Calabar on Oct. 26.</p>
<p>He said that traditional rulers&#8217; involvement in partisan politics posed a threat to their position as guides to &#8220;how we communally live, intermingle, interact and prosper together, as a people&#8221;.</p>
<p>Muhammad said that traditional institutions were the only lasting legacy that the rest of the world could identify to be &#8220;originally what belongs to us&#8221;.</p>
<p>&#8220;Their arbitrary function in moments of dispute between families or communities is grossly undermined by their active participation in politics.&#8221;</p>
<p>The commissioner said that those empowered by circumstance, try to bring the paramount rulers to convey to their lieutenants, down to the people &#8220;all sorts of campaign instruments and stop at nothing to win elections&#8221;.</p>
<p>&#8220;In this manner, they are being recruited by mainstream politicians, cowed and misdirected to outrun the bounds of inheritance and unwittingly overstep the ancestry limits which unfortunately compromise their position in history.&#8221;</p>
<p>He noted that traditional rulers who joined the ruling party that failed to win re-election were subjected to all manner of threat and intimidation, while their colleagues who were neutral are demoted or deposed by the winning party.</p>
<p>Muhammad said that this had become part of &#8220;our democratisation process and the outcome, include loss of lives and property, as well as permanent memories to live with&#8221;.</p>
<p>He also drew the council&#8217;s attention to the involvement of civil servants in partisan politics, especially at the beginning of every electioneering campaign, in the bid to enhance their prospect of promotion or posting, when elections are won or lost.</p>
<p>&#8220;The council may have to take a look at the adverse effects of the involvement of career civil servants in partisan politics on the civil service system.</p>
<p>&#8220;It may also wish to look into ways of exempting traditional rulers and civil servants from active participation in politics,&#8221; he said.</p>
<p>Muhammad called for sustainable mass media campaign to enlighten the traditional rulers, civil servants and all stakeholders on the need to ban traditional rulers and career civil servants from participating in anyway in politics.</p>
<p>The commissioner was represented by the Permanent Secretary in the Ministry, Hajiya Dije Gusau.</p>
<p>The 3-day conference is being attended by state commissioners for information, permanents secretaries in the state ministries of information and their counterpart at the federal level.</p>
<p>It is expected to be officially declared open on Oct. 27 by the Minster of Information Labaran Maku.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A Non-Governmental Organisation, Girls Power Initiative (GPI), has called on the National Assembly to enact a law on violence against women.<br />
The NGO also said the national assembly should stop debate on the Indecent Dressing Bill sponsored by Senator Eme Ekaette, saying the passage of the bill will increase violence against women.<br />
The Co-ordinator of Calabar Centre of GPI, Professor Bene Madunagu, addressing the press in Calabar in reaction to the murder of Miss Grace Ushang in Maiduguri, Borno State while participating in the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) scheme said all Nigerians should condemn the death of the corps member.<br />
Madunagu also expressed regret that the Director-General of the NYSC rather than condemn the rape and violence that led to the death of Ushang was blaming the late Corps member for not taking security precautions.<br />
&#8220;Rather than denounce this for the crime that it is and reassure our young graduates on national service that well-being preoccupies the highest levels of decision making, the Director-General mere advised Youth Corpers to &#8216;take their personal security seriously because whatever we provided is not enough. They must learn to be security-conscious&#8217;. Pray, how?&#8221; she queried.<br />
She recalled that the Chairperson of the Senate Committee on women, Senator Eme Ekaette had in 2008 introduced a bill in the Senate to prohibit indecent dressing.<br />
She said that at the public hearing on the Bill, it became obvious that the Bill proposes to &#8220;grant intolerably dangerous powers of arrest and invasion of the most intimate privacies of the woman&#8217;s body imaginable to both police officers and ordinary citizens to undertake vigilante action against women they mere perceive to be indecently dressed&#8221;.<br />
According to Madunagu, &#8220;The compounded crimes that killed Grace Ushang painfully return our attention to the pervasiveness of violence against women in Nigeria and the growing resort to vigilante action to police vague notions of feminine propriety and decency&#8221;.<br />
She said Ushang&#8217;s story demonstrated the fallacy of the justifications for laws like Senator Ekaette&#8217;s Indecent Dressing Bill, stressing that those who wish to commit crimes of sexual violence need no excuse.<br />
&#8220;They must be treated like the predators they are. If a woman, like Grace Ushang, dressed in regulation clothing prescribed by the Federal Republic of Nigeria is considered to be so indecently dressed as to be put to death by the most vile acts of violence imaginable;<br />
&#8220;How do we guarantee the safety and security of Nigerian women in the uniformed services, such as the armed Forces, Police, Prisons Service and immigration?&#8221; she asked.<br />
She said to immortalise the memory of the slain Grace Ushang, the National Assembly should pass a law on violence against wome</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>JUST SOME THOUGHTS</p>
<p>It is a pity that our leaders  continue to take the citizens for a ride. Our society is becoming lawless day by day; the leadership and institutional discipline that should be the bedrock upon which our future should be built is fast being eroded.</p>
<p>It has become clear that sometimes, to make progress, our leaders needs to be wiped like cows to drive in some ideas into their brain. There is a strong need to ensure – before election (selection) or appointment – that there exists a balance between theoretical and practical buoyancy in the thinking faculty of the species of Homo sapiens inhabiting this country.</p>
<p>However, it was not always like this in the beginning, the Awolowo, Azikiwe and Ahmadu Bello of this country were men rich with ideas and ideologies. These were men who positively impacted on the society through their ideas and strive for a better living condition for the citizenry.  Their effort, though may be seen as regionally or ethnically directed, was still focused on giving the inhabitants of the region a sense of belonging and happiness.</p>
<p>It is a tragic pity that we have metamorphosed to a stage where scruples has been a virtue for the fools, to a time where ideas are no longer relevant in politics and governance, a time where fraudulent money can answer all thing – even power and human life. A time where our future is becoming an issue of political gamble.  A time where no institution is functional, a time where the children prefer living in exile while their home burns to ashes. Is there still light in the tunnel?</p>
